What does "otter" mean?
-
noun A sleek, semi-aquatic mammal with dense fur that hunts fish and other prey in rivers or coastal waters.
"A pair of otters played in the shallows near the dock."
-
noun Informally, a slim, hairy man, especially used within gay culture to contrast with a stockier "bear."
"He described himself as more of an otter than a bear."
